The mol-ecule of the title compound, CHN, exhibits inversion symmetry adopting the shape of a St Andrew's Cross. It shows dihedral angles between adjacent aryl units of around 50° whereas torsion angles of 10° are found along the aryl-ene vinyl-ene path.
